Every year, between late November and early January, the municipality of Lavis, in the province of Trento, lights up with Christmas in Lavis: an extensive calendar of scattered events that transforms the historic center, the squares, and the hamlets of Pressano and Sorni into a grand festive village. Rather than a single market, it is a true community calendar, built together by the Municipality and the Pro Loco Lavis with the support of numerous local associations.
The program weaves together the most deeply rooted traditions of Trentino-Alto Adige with activities designed for all ages. Highlights include the arrival of Saint Nicholas and the Krampus parade in early December, the scattered nativity scenes set up throughout the town streets and hamlets, the living nativity organized by the local parish, and the Saint Lucy festival with the traditional Strozega. A special role is played by the Potachin elf, who hides in shop windows from December 1st to 24th, turning holiday shopping into a treasure hunt for children.
The soundtrack of the festivities is provided by numerous concerts echoing in the parish church and local halls: from polyphonic and social choirs to the traditional Christmas Concert and the New Year's Concert. Alongside music, there are theatrical performances, children's readings with kamishibai theater, and a film festival at the Municipal Auditorium, organized in collaboration with Nuovo Astra, featuring family films, documentaries, and auteur cinema.
One of the hallmarks of Christmas in Lavis is the immersive tours of the Giardino dei Ciucioi, the historic romantic garden that opens its doors for sensory experiences dedicated to Christmas, as well as many creative workshops for adults and children, ranging from baking Christmas sweets to botanical printing using the cyanotype technique. The spirit of solidarity is also strong, with initiatives like "Your gift for those who are alone" promoted by the Pro Loco together with the Lavistaperta cultural circle.
With its blend of faith, folklore, culture, and participation, Christmas in Lavis is much more than a festival: it is the way an entire Trentino town experiences the time of Advent and the holidays together. Most events are free to attend, while some workshops and visits to the Giardino dei Ciucioi require a contribution and booking, given the limited availability.
Lavis is located a few kilometers north of Trento, along the Brenner road. By car, it can be reached from the San Michele all'Adige-Mezzocorona (A22) motorway exit or from Trento North. By train, the Lavis station is served by the Trento-Malè-Mezzana line (Trentino Trasporti).
Most events are free. Some workshops (starting from 3 euros) and immersive tours of the Giardino dei Ciucioi (approx. 10 euros) have limited capacity and require booking. The film festival at the Auditorium features tickets ranging from 5 to 8 euros.
